Gardens of the Mediterranean – Mike Nelhams – Lecture

Thursday 21 October 2021 at 7:00 pm to 8:00 pm

Mike Nelhams, AHRHS, FI Hort, Curator, Tresco Abbey Garden, studied for three years at the RHS Garden, Wisley and first went to Tresco on a Studley Trust Scholarship as a student in 1976. After managing a woodland garden in Sussex for five years he returned to Tresco Abbey Garden in 1984 as Head Gardener and then in 1994 took the post which was established for him of Garden Curator. He is an RHS judge on the Tender Plants Committee and has judged at Chelsea, Hampton Court and London RHS shows.He has published a book, Tresco Abbey Garden, made many appearances on TV and radio, as well as writing many articles for the horticultural press.

Mike has a particular interest in plants from the Mediterranean and associated coastal regions of the world and leads garden tours to South Africa, Australia, New Zealand, Japan, St Lucia, South America, California, Italy and the South of France.

He has visited many marvellous gardens across the area we call the Mediterranean and will take us on a mini tour across France, Italy, Sicily and the Canary Isles looking at some of the highlights, with particular reference to the Hanbury Garden where for many years Mike has annually taken the Tresco garden team for work experience…. along with the occasional glass of wine on a sunny terrace!!
